That Fuzziness? It’s Often Just Bad Settings
Sharpness. On a monitor, it’s not about how *physically* sharp the screen is, like a blade. Instead, it’s an image processing setting that influences how defined the edges of objects appear. Think of it like digitally enhancing an old photo. Too little, and everything looks soft, smudged, almost watercolor-esque. Too much, and you get this hideous, artificial halo effect around everything, making text look like it’s shouting at you through a cheap amplifier.

Why Over-Sharpening Is a Digital Disaster
Everyone thinks more sharpness is better, like adding more RAM to a computer. I used to be in that camp. I figured, why wouldn’t you want the sharpest image possible? It’s the most accurate representation, right? Nope. That’s where I was dead wrong. When you push the sharpness setting too high on a monitor, it artificially enhances the contrast along the edges of objects. This can create what’s called ‘ringing’ or ‘halos’ – a bright, sometimes colored, outline around lines and text. It’s not natural; it’s an artifact. It makes everything look harsh and can actually make text *harder* to read because your eyes are trying to process this fake edge definition.
So, what does monitor sharpness do when it’s cranked to eleven? It makes your image look like a bad JPEG that’s been saved and re-saved a dozen times. It’s the digital equivalent of using too much HDR filter on a photo and making it look garish. I’ve seen monitors where text looked like it was outlined in neon, and I’ve had to tell people, “No, your monitor isn’t broken, you’ve just mangled the sharpness setting.”
According to DisplayMate, a highly respected display testing laboratory, pushing sharpness beyond the native pixel level often introduces artifacts without actually improving perceived detail. They’ve spent years showing how proper calibration, not aggressive sharpening, is the key to a great image. Trying to force sharpness is like trying to make a low-resolution JPEG look like a 4K RAW file – you’re just adding noise and distortion.
It’s a trap many fall into, thinking they’re getting a better image when they’re actually degrading it. Finding the Sweet Spot: It’s Not Rocket Science, but It’s Close
So, where do you find that magical middle ground? It’s different for every monitor, and even for different content. My general rule of thumb, honed through countless hours of fiddling and more than a few moments of eye strain, is to start low and go slow. Most monitors have a sharpness setting that goes from 0 to 100, or sometimes 0 to 10. The sweet spot is usually somewhere in the middle, often around 40-60% of the maximum. Some monitors are even better with sharpness set to 50, which some manufacturers intend to represent a neutral setting where no artificial edge enhancement is applied.
When you’re adjusting, look at fine text. Is it crisp and easy to read, with no fuzzy halo? Then look at a detailed image – are the fine lines and textures visible without looking jagged or surrounded by glowing outlines? If the answer is yes to both, you’re likely in the right zone. If you start seeing that artificial glow, back it off immediately. It’s like tuning a guitar; you want it in tune, not just loud.

People Also Ask
What Happens If Monitor Sharpness Is Too High?
If your monitor’s sharpness setting is too high, you’ll notice artificial halos or glowing outlines around text and objects. This is often called ‘ringing’ or ‘overshooting.’ It makes the image look unnatural, harsh, and can actually make fine details appear muddier than they would at a lower sharpness setting. Text becomes harder to read, and images lose their natural depth.
Can Sharpness Affect Image Quality?
Absolutely. Sharpness is a direct image quality setting. Too little sharpness results in a soft, blurry image lacking definition. Too much sharpness creates artifacts like halos and jagged edges, which also degrade image quality. What Is the Ideal Sharpness Setting for Gaming?
For gaming, the ideal sharpness setting is usually moderate. You want clear, defined edges for fast-moving objects and details, but you don’t want excessive sharpening that creates distracting halos. Start around the 50-60% mark and adjust based on how the game looks and feels. Some games have built-in sharpening filters, so consider those too before tweaking the monitor’s setting.
What Is the Best Sharpness Setting for Text?
For text, especially for productivity or reading, aim for clarity without harshness. A sharpness setting that’s too high will create prominent halos around letters, making them appear jagged and fatiguing to read. A setting that’s too low will make the text appear blurry. The sweet spot is typically where the text is perfectly crisp and readable with no visible artificial enhancement.
What Does Monitor Sharpness Do in Windows?
In Windows, the ‘Sharpness’ setting refers to the monitor’s built-in image processing. It’s not a Windows software adjustment in the same way as ClearType. When you adjust sharpness in your monitor’s OSD (On-Screen Display) menu, you’re telling the monitor’s internal scaler how much to enhance edges in the image it’s receiving from your PC. Windows itself has ClearType for text smoothing, but monitor sharpness affects the entire display.
